#author("2023-05-28T07:07:21+00:00","default:hotate","hotate") #author("2023-05-28T07:07:49+00:00","default:hotate","hotate") #contents &tag(Homebrew,画像処理); * 情報 [#kf0636d4] - [[開発メモ: ImageMagickで「自然な彩度」強調>http://fallabs.com/blog-ja/promenade.cgi?id=164]] ガンマ補正とシグモイド補正の適性なパラメータを決めるには、変換後のヒストグラムの変化を見ながら実験を繰り返すとよい - [[本当は速いImageMagick: サムネイル画像生成を10倍速くする方法 - 昼メシ物語>http://blog.mirakui.com/entry/20110123/1295795409]] ImageMagick は、 -define jpeg:size={width}x{height} というオプションが与えられると、実際の画像サイズの 1/2、1/4、1/8 のサイズの中から、オプションで指定されたサイズに近いものを選び、そのサイズとして画像を開きます。 * [[Homebrew]] [#acc9779f] - [[HomeBrew で古いバージョンをインストールするもうひとつの方法 - Qiita>http://qiita.com/satosystems/items/8587527b185a91abfb37]] RMagick が ImageMagick 6.9.0 を要求するも、Mac 環境では ImageMagick 6.9.1 がインストールされており、rails が起動できないという状況です。 - [[【小ネタ】homebrewでインストールされるimagemagickのバージョンを固定する | Developers.IO>http://dev.classmethod.jp/etc/brew-pin/]] 簡単に行う方法を探してみたところ、brew pinを使う方法(URL)が見つかりました。 * [[コマンド]] [#e37e445d] ** mogrify [#f381e0ec] - [[ImageMagick mogrifyコマンドで画像を一括でリサイズする | アナライズギア開発ブログ>https://analyzegear.co.jp/blog/1561]] ImageMagickがインストールされている環境であれば mogrifyコマンドで一括処理する方法が便利です。 - [[ImageMagick で画像のフォーマットを複数ファイル一括変換する場合は mogrify を使う(convert でなく) - 約束の地>https://obel.hatenablog.jp/entry/20210329/1616961600]] # カレントディレクトリの全ての .jpg を .png に変換して出力する(拡張子を除いた名前部分は変更なし) $ mogrify -format png *.jpg - [[ImageMagickを使って『画像への枠線追加』処理を一括で行う | DevelopersIO>https://dev.classmethod.jp/articles/add-border-to-image-by-imagemagick/]] % mogrify -bordercolor "#0000ff" -border 30x30 -path ./output *.png - [[imagemagicでpdfをjpgにconvertしたらbackgroundが黒くなるとき - Qiita>https://qiita.com/prex-uchida/items/8443c5350e80c25c4efa]] pdfをjpgにすると背景が黒くなってしまうことがあります。そんなときは、-alpha remove オプションを使います! * 関連 [#m5dd5ff7] #taglist(tag=画像処理)